Another issue might be overmixing the filling when adding in the whipped cream. You want to fold it in gently to maintain the airiness, as overmixing can lead to a denser cheesecake instead of the light, fluffy delight we’re going for.
Also, it’s essential to use fresh Twix bars. Old or stale candies can change the texture and flavor, and you really want that crispy and chewy experience in each delicious bite. If you’re buying Twix from a store, check the expiration date and grab a fresh box!
Lastly, I’ve found that cutting the cheesecake too soon can lead to messy slices. It’s crucial to let the cheesecake set for the full time; if it’s still too soft, the presentation won’t be as pretty. Just be patient, and the results will be worth it!

Variations & Customizations
The great thing about this cheesecake is its versatility! If you’re a fan of peanut butter, consider swirling in some creamy peanut butter into the filling for added richness. The combination of chocolate, caramel, and peanut butter is heavenly and takes this delight to a whole new level!
For a fruity twist, try adding some chopped strawberries or bananas into the filling, or even layering them between the crust and filling. The freshness of the fruit really brightens up the flavor profile and provides a lovely color contrast to the cheesecake, perfect for summer gatherings.
If you’re looking for a gluten-free option, simply substitute the graham crackers for gluten-free cookies or almond flour crust. This way, everyone can enjoy this delightful treat, and the flavors will still be absolutely divine!
How to Store, Freeze & Reheat
Storing this cheesecake is a breeze! Just cover it with plastic wrap or aluminum foil and keep it in the refrigerator. It will last for about 5-7 days, but trust me, it’s unlikely to last that long!
If you’d like to make this cheesecake in advance, you can freeze it for up to two months. Just be sure to wrap it well in plastic wrap and then foil to prevent freezer burn. When you’re ready to enjoy it, simply thaw it in the fridge overnight.
Reheating isn’t necessary for this no-bake cheesecake, but if you have leftover slices, allowing them to reach room temperature before serving can enhance the flavors. I find that letting them sit out for just a bit brings out the best in every bite!
